Next.js Dashboard Template with Sidebar, Tables & Analytics

A production-ready Next.js dashboard template with responsive sidebar navigation, sortable data tables, analytics panels, and accessible form controls. Built with Tailwind CSS and shadcn/ui.

Starting at $79· 7-day money-back guarantee

Building a dashboard from scratch means wrestling with sidebar navigation, responsive layouts, data table interactions, and form controls — all before your first feature. This Next.js dashboard template gives you a complete admin panel foundation with a collapsible sidebar, topbar navigation, sortable data tables with pagination, settings pages, and toast notifications. Every component is accessible (WCAG AA), built with production-ready architecture, and ships with real-world workflows.

Key Features

Responsive Sidebar Navigation

Collapsible sidebar with keyboard navigation, mobile drawer, and active state indicators.

Sortable Data Tables

Tables with column sorting, pagination, row selection, and keyboard-accessible controls.

Settings Panels

Profile, preferences, and account settings screens with form validation.

Dashboard Starter

Empty-state dashboard ready for your charts, metrics, and analytics components.

Toast Notifications

Success and error notifications with accessible announcements for screen readers.

Dark Mode Toggle

System-aware dark mode with smooth transitions and token-driven colors.

How thefrontkit Compares

FeaturethefrontkitTypical Alternatives
AccessibilityWCAG AA from the startOften an afterthought
Sidebar NavigationCollapsible, mobile-readyFixed width only
Data TablesSort, paginate, keyboard navBasic rendering
Design TokensProduction-ready token systemHardcoded styles

Ready to Ship Faster?

Skip the boilerplate and start building what matters. Production-ready, accessible, and token-synced.

View SaaS Starter Kit

Related Resources

Frequently Asked Questions